Course Content

• Introduction to Molecular Dynamics Simulations and their Applications in Genomics
• Force Fields and Parameterization for Biomolecules
• Molecular Dynamics Simulation Techniques: Algorithms and Methodologies
• Analysis of Molecular Dynamics Trajectories: Essential Tools and Techniques (RMSD, RMSF, etc.)
• Computational Genomics Applications of MD: Protein-DNA Interactions
• Advanced Sampling Methods in Molecular Dynamics for challenging systems
• High-Performance Computing for Molecular Dynamics Simulations
• Case Studies: Molecular Dynamics in Drug Discovery and Genome Editing
• Data Visualization and Interpretation of MD Simulations

Career path

Career Role (Molecular Dynamics & Computational Genomics) Description
Bioinformatician (Molecular Dynamics Specialist) Develops and applies computational methods, including molecular dynamics simulations, to analyze biological data, focusing on genomic applications. High demand for expertise in algorithm development and large-scale data analysis.
Computational Biologist (Genomics Focus) Conducts research utilizing molecular dynamics simulations and other computational techniques to understand biological processes at the genomic level. Requires strong programming skills and a deep understanding of genomics.
Data Scientist (Computational Genomics) Applies statistical and machine learning methods to genomic datasets, often integrating molecular dynamics simulations to interpret complex biological phenomena. Expertise in data visualization and interpretation crucial.
Research Scientist (Molecular Dynamics Simulations) Conducts independent research using molecular dynamics and other simulation techniques to investigate fundamental biological processes related to genomics. Strong publication record and grant writing experience highly valued.
